Advanced Google Sheets Formulas You Need to Know
Unlock the maximum potential of your Google Sheets skills by understanding some powerful formulas. Beyond elementary SUM and AVERAGE, consider delving within functions like INDEX/MATCH for adaptable lookups, ARRAYFORMULA to automate calculations across entire rows or columns, and QUERY for extracting specific data. Furthermore, explore the nuances concerning functions like VLOOKUP/HLOOKUP, DATE/TIME functions, and even try to grasp conditional logic with IF and nested IF statements – they're a game-changer for analytics management and reporting .

Google Sheets vs. Microsoft Excel : Which Table is Suitable for Users?
Choosing between Google Sheets and Excel can be tricky, as both give powerful table capabilities. Google Sheets truly stands out with its online nature, allowing for easy collaboration and viewing from virtually anywhere. This makes it especially beneficial for groups that require simultaneous editing . However , Excel remains a dominant force, particularly for users needing sophisticated functionality like in-depth formulas, vast charting capabilities , and offline performance . Think about your specific situation - if teamwork is essential, Google Sheets likely be a superior choice .
